На 2025 год продолжают набирать популярность языки программирования, которые отвечают современным требованиям веб-разработки и анализа данных. Среди них JavaScript и Python остаются в лидерах благодаря своей универсальности и широкому спектру библиотек. Эти языки подходят как для создания динамичных веб-приложений, так и для разработки решений в области машинного обучения.
К новинкам в списке популярных языков можно отнести Rust, который выделяется высокой производительностью и безопасностью управления памятью. Он становится все более востребованным в сферах системного программирования и разработки многопоточных приложений, особенно в контексте мобильной разработки.
Совсем недавно на рынке появился язык Julia, получивший признание благодаря своей эффективности в математическом моделировании и анализе данных. В 2025 году его применение активно расширяется в корпоративных проектам, что способствует росту интереса со стороны специалистов в области компьютерных наук.
Выбор языка зависит от специфики задач: для веб-разработки подойдут JavaScript и TypeScript, в то время как Python и R остаются оптимальными для аналитики и обработки больших данных. Обратите внимание на эти языки при выборе технологий для ваших проектов в 2025 году.
Популярные языки программирования для разработчиков в 2025
На первом месте по популярности в 2025 году остаётся Python. Благодаря простоте синтаксиса и мощным библиотекам для работы с искусственным интеллектом, он идеально подходит как для начинающих, так и для профессионалов.
JavaScript продолжает доминировать в веб-разработке. Секрет его успеха заключается в обширной экосистеме фреймворков, таких как React и Angular, которые позволяют создавать интерактивные и отзывчивые пользовательские интерфейсы.
Java остаётся ключевым языком для разработки корпоративных приложений. Прочные типы и богатая библиотека делают его основным выбором для крупных IT-проектов и системных приложений.
Для мобильной разработки Swift и Kotlin предлагают удобные инструменты. Swift используется для iOS-приложений, а Kotlin – для Android, оба языка обеспечивают высокую производительность и безопасность.
Go gaining popularity в 2025 году из-за своей скорости и эффективности в создании высоконагруженных систем. Этот язык подходит для разработки микросервисов и облачных решений.
Среди новых трендов выделяется TypeScript, который привносит строгую типизацию в JavaScript, что улучшает масштабируемость больших приложений и облегчает работу командных разработчиков в сложных проектах.
Развитие программных технологий предполагает, что языки, такие как Rust и Dart, также будут набирать популярность из-за своей надёжности и производительности, что особенно важно в области системного программирования и приложений для веба.
В итоге, выбор языка зависит от целей: Python и JavaScript для начинающих, Java и Go для крупных проектов, Swift и Kotlin для мобильной разработки. Осваивайте актуальные IT-технологии, чтобы быть конкурентоспособным в индустрии компьютерных наук.
Новые языки программирования: тренды и перспективы
Для начинающих разработчиков стоит обратить внимание на язык программирования Rust, который активно используется в системном программировании и разработки высокопроизводительных приложений. Его безопасность и производительность делают его востребованным в веб-разработке и анализе данных.
Еще один язык, который станет популярным в 2025 году, это Julia. Он подходит для сценариев научных вычислений и анализа данных благодаря своей скорости и простоте. Julia уже получает одобрение в академической среде и среди специалистов в области машинного обучения.
TypeScript продолжает набирать популярность среди разработчиков, учитывая его совместимость с JavaScript и поддержку современных программных технологий. Этот язык упрощает создание масштабируемых приложений и становится стандартом для фронтенд-разработки.
Также стоит отметить язык Go, который идеально подходит для разработки микросервисов и облачных приложений. Его высокие показатели производительности и простота синтаксиса делают его привлекательным для проектов, требующих быстрой реализации и масштабирования.
В сфере блокчейн-технологий язык Solidity продолжает оставаться в числе лидеров. За счет своей специфики, он привлекает разработчиков, заинтересованных в создании децентрализованных приложений и смарт-контрактов.
Языки программирования будущего будут продолжать эволюционировать, опираясь на потребности IT-технологий и стремление к упрощению создания и поддержки программного обеспечения. Разработчикам стоит следить за новыми инструментами и тенденциями, чтобы оставаться конкурентоспособными в быстро меняющемся мире.
Как выбрать язык программирования для начинающих и профессионалов
При выборе языка программирования для начинающих и опытных разработчиков важно учитывать текущие тенденции в it-технологиях. На 2025 год наблюдается устойчивый рост таких направлений, как искусственный интеллект, веб-разработка и мобильная разработка.
Начинающим рекомендовано обратить внимание на следующие языки:
- Python: Отлично подходит для старта в программировании. Широко используется в искусственном интеллекте и научных приложениях.
- JavaScript: Необходим для веб-разработки, позволяет создавать интерактивные элементы на сайтах.
- Java: Популярен в корпоративной разработке и мобильных приложениях на платформе Android.
- Ruby: Хорош для веб-разработки и подходит для создания стартапов благодаря своей простоте.
Профессионалы должны ориентироваться на следующие языки, востребованные в новых технологиях:
- Go: Разработан для высокопроизводительных приложений и облачных сервисов.
- Kotlin: Является основным языком для мобильной разработки на Android.
- Rust: Выбор для системного программирования, надежный и эффективный в использовании.
- Swift: Основной язык для разработки приложений на iOS.
Рекомендуется учитывать следующие факторы при выборе языка:
- Цели проекта: Ориентируйтесь на специфику разработки, например, веб-сайты, мобильные приложения или системное ПО.
- Сообщество и ресурсы: Наличие поддерживающего сообщества и обучающих материалов значительно облегчит процесс обучения.
- Востребованность: Изучайте актуальный рынок труда, чтобы выбрать язык с высокой вероятностью трудоустройства.
- Потенциал для карьерного роста: Предпочитайте языки, которые открывают новые возможности в рамках быстроразвивающихся технологий.
Выбор языка программирования имеет решающее значение как для начинающих, так и для профессионалов, и должен базироваться на актуальных знаниях о текущих трендах и потребностях индустрии.